Where Most Bath Soap Packaging Goes Wrong
At first glance, soap packaging feels easy.
It isn’t.
You pack a few bars, stack them, ship them. Then you open a returned batch and see chipped corners, slight dents, sometimes even surface marks. That usually comes from the box, not the soap.
Loose boxes let the product move. Tight ones damage edges during packing.

Material Choice Isn’t Just About Looks
Cardboard and kraft are the usual starting points. Both do the job, but they behave differently once used.
Cardboard is smooth. Printing looks cleaner, sharper. If your soaps sit under store lights, this matters more than people expect.
Kraft feels different. Slightly rough, more natural. It doesn’t show small scratches easily, which helps during shipping and storage.
Rigid boxes? Not common for single soaps, but useful for gift sets. They change how the product feels instantly.
So the choice isn’t just visual. It’s about how the box holds up after being handled 20 times.
How Different Soap Box Styles Actually Perform
Most people go with tuck-end boxes. Simple, quick to assemble, easy to stack. Good for custom soap boxes wholesale orders.
But after some time, you’ll notice the flaps soften. Especially in retail where boxes get opened again and again.
Some brands switch to die-cut soap boxes when they want better shape control or visual detail. These allow custom openings or patterns while keeping structure balanced.
Sleeve boxes feel smoother when opening. Cleaner experience. But sizing has to be precise. Even a small mismatch and the sleeve won’t behave properly.
Window boxes look great on shelves. Especially bath soap boxes with window. But they need stronger board because of the cut-out area.
What Happens in Real Use
Retail is rougher than expected.
Customers pick boxes up, press them slightly, put them back. Thin stock loses shape quickly in that environment.
Shipping brings a different problem. Weight. Boxes stacked on top of each other can crush the lower layers if structure is weak.
Storage is quieter, but still risky. Humidity slowly affects board strength. Kraft tends to handle that better than coated surfaces.

Printing and Finishing, Keep It Practical
Not everything needs heavy finishing.
Matte works well. It hides fingerprints and keeps the surface looking clean even after handling.
Gloss looks brighter but shows scratches faster. That’s something many brands only notice after distribution.
Foil or embossing can add value, but for regular soap lines, simple printing often works better.

Getting the Size Right Takes Thought
Soap sizes are rarely perfect. Especially handmade ones.
If your box is built too tight, packing slows down. Bars get stuck. Edges get damaged.
Too loose, and the soap shifts inside. That movement causes small dents over time.
A slight tolerance solves both problems.

Durability Isn’t Just Thickness
Thicker board helps, but design matters more.
Side support, fold strength, how the box locks. These small details decide how the box performs during shipping.
Soap edges are sensitive. They chip more easily than expected.

Branding Without Overdoing It
Soap is already a sensory product.
Strong scents, textures, colors. The packaging shouldn’t compete with that.
Clean layout works better. Product name, a bit of brand identity, maybe color variation for different scents.

Bath Soap Packaging Specifications |
|
|---|---|
| Material Options | SBS paperboard (250–350 gsm), white cardboard stock, natural kraft board for organic brands, bux board for added durability, FSC-certified recyclable materials, optional moisture-resistant coating for bathroom storage. |
| Packaging Style | Reverse tuck end (RTE) soap boxes, straight tuck end (STE), sleeve-style soap packaging, die-cut window boxes, two-piece rigid boxes for premium soaps, wrap-around paper sleeves for handmade soaps. |
| Product Protection | Moisture-resistant inner layer, secure closures to prevent exposure, protects soap shape and texture, prevents contamination and damage, suitable for both dry and slightly moist soap products. |
| Ventilation & Freshness | Optional ventilation die-cuts for handmade soaps, breathable packaging design to prevent moisture buildup, helps maintain fragrance and product quality, ideal for organic and natural soap lines. |
| Surface Finish & Texture | Matte or gloss lamination, anti-scuff coating, soft-touch finish for premium feel, UV coating for durability, kraft texture for eco-friendly branding. |
| Printing & Branding Options | Offset and digital printing, CMYK and Pantone color matching, ingredient and usage instructions printing, barcode and compliance labeling, foil stamping, embossing/debossing, spot UV highlights, inside printing optional. |
| Retail Display Compatibility | Shelf-ready packaging for retail stores, window cut-outs for product visibility, compact design for retail racks, ideal for supermarkets, pharmacies, and handmade soap shops. |
| Durability & Handling | Sturdy structure for handling and transport, reinforced edges to prevent bending, lightweight yet protective, maintains box integrity during storage and shipping. |
| Custom Sizes & Dimensions | Custom sizes based on soap bar dimensions, options for single or multi-pack soaps, adjustable depth for different soap thicknesses, flexible sizing for retail and wholesale packaging. |
| Wholesale & Production | Low MOQs for small brands, bulk production pricing, custom dieline development, pre-production sampling, consistent print and structural quality control. |
| Sustainability Options | Recyclable and biodegradable materials, soy-based inks, plastic-free packaging options, eco-friendly coatings, sustainable solutions for soap and personal care brands. |
